China labeled as 'dangerous' comments by a senior US diplomat that the AUKUS submarine project between Australia, UK and the US could help deter any Chinese move against Taiwan.
BEIJING — China 's government on Wednesday labeled as "dangerous" comments by a senior US diplomat that the AUKUS submarine project between Australia , Britain and the United States could help deter any Chinese move against Taiwan .The project, finalized by the three countries last year, involves Australia acquiring nuclear-powered attack submarines as part of the allies' efforts to push back against China 's growing power in the Indo-Pacific region.
Any attempt to use military cooperation to "intervene in the Taiwan issue is to interfere in China's internal affairs" and is a threat to peace and stability in the Taiwan Strait region, Zhu said.The US, Britain and Australia formed AUKUS in 2021, part of their efforts to push back against China's growing power in the Indo-Pacific region. China has called the AUKUS pact dangerous and warned it could spur a regional arms race.
